SA1 39203 is characterised by a high share of renters and fewer residents than most areas.
It also has slightly more people living alone than usual and a slightly more educated population.
Explore SA1 39203 by topic
SA1 39203 is home to 253 people — well below average. Children under 15 make up 11.1% of SA1 39203's population, well below average (below both the New South Wales average of 18.2% and the national 18.2%). The most common age structure is Young adults (25–44) at 36%, ahead of Older adults (45–64) (21%). 14.0% of people in SA1 39203 are in a de facto relationship, above average (above both the New South Wales average of 10.6% and the national 11.5%).
51.4% of residents in SA1 39203 were born overseas — well above average (above both the New South Wales average of 29.3% and the national 27.7%). The most common country of birth is Australia at 43%, ahead of China (5%).
51.4% of residents in SA1 39203 use a language other than English at home — well above average (above both the New South Wales average of 26.6% and the national 22.3%). 7.9% of people in SA1 39203 speak English not well or not at all, well above average (above both the New South Wales average of 4.5% and the national 3.4%). The most common language used at home is English only at 43%, ahead of Greek (8%).
32.0% of people in SA1 39203 report no religion — below average (below both the New South Wales average of 33.2% and the national 38.9%). The most common religious affiliation is Christianity at 44%, ahead of No religion (32%).
32.6% of adults in SA1 39203 hold a bachelor degree or higher — above average (above both the New South Wales average of 27.8% and the national 26.3%). 71.1% of people in SA1 39203 finished Year 12, well above average (above both the New South Wales average of 58.9% and the national 58.8%). The most common highest year of school is Year 12 at 71%, ahead of Year 10 (11%).
The median household income in SA1 39203 is $1,489 a week — below average (below both the New South Wales average of $1,829 and the national $1,746). 9.6% of households in SA1 39203 bring in $3,000 or more a week, well below average (below both the New South Wales average of 25.2% and the national 22.6%). The most common household income distribution is $1,500–$2,999 at 43%, ahead of $650–$1,499 (35%). The median personal income in SA1 39203 is $707 a week, below average (below both the New South Wales average of $813 and the national $805).
23.3% of residents in SA1 39203 live with a long-term health condition — below average (below both the New South Wales average of 27.0% and the national 27.7%). 7.1% of residents in SA1 39203 need help with daily activities, above average (above both the New South Wales average of 5.8% and the national 5.8%). The most common long-term health conditions reported is Other condition at 11%, ahead of Mental health (8%). 7.5% of people in SA1 39203 report a mental health condition, below average (below both the New South Wales average of 8.0% and the national 8.8%).
13.7% of people in SA1 39203 volunteer — around the middle of the range (above the New South Wales average of 13.0% but below the national 14.1%). 0.0% of people in SA1 39203 have served in the Defence Force, among the lowest in the country (below both the New South Wales average of 2.3% and the national 2.8%). 16.3% of people in SA1 39203 look after children without pay, well below average (below both the New South Wales average of 25.3% and the national 26.3%).
Households in SA1 39203 average 2.3 people — below average. 31.7% of households in SA1 39203 are single-person households, well above average (above both the New South Wales average of 25.0% and the national 25.6%). The most common family composition is Couples with children at 52%, ahead of Couples without children (29%). One-parent families make up 17.8% of families in SA1 39203, above average (above both the New South Wales average of 14.0% and the national 14.1%).
Renters in SA1 39203 pay a median $390 a week — around the middle of the range (below the New South Wales average of $420 but above the national $375). 30.8% of dwellings in SA1 39203 are separate houses, well below average (below both the New South Wales average of 65.6% and the national 72.3%). The most common how homes are owned or rented is Rented at 51%, ahead of Owned outright (29%). 47.1% of homes in SA1 39203 have three or more bedrooms, well below average (below both the New South Wales average of 68.6% and the national 73.8%).
23.3% of households in SA1 39203 have no car — among the highest in the country (above both the New South Wales average of 9.2% and the national 7.4%). 44.2% of workers in SA1 39203 work from home, well above average (above both the New South Wales average of 31.0% and the national 21.0%). The most common how people get to work is Worked at home at 44%, ahead of Car (driver) (24%). 4.4% of workers in SA1 39203 get to work by public transport, well above average (above both the New South Wales average of 2.7% and the national 3.1%).
47.6% of people in SA1 39203 changed address in the past five years — well above average (above both the New South Wales average of 39.9% and the national 40.7%). 20.0% of SA1 39203's residents arrived from overseas within the past five years, well above average (above both the New South Wales average of 14.9% and the national 14.5%).
SA1 39203's unemployment rate is 6.7% — above average (above both the New South Wales average of 4.9% and the national 5.1%). 48.7% of workers in SA1 39203 are employed full-time, well below average (below both the New South Wales average of 58.0% and the national 58.9%). The most common industries people work in is Health care & social assistance at 15%, ahead of Education & training (12%). Labour-force participation in SA1 39203 is 52.4%, well below average (below both the New South Wales average of 58.7% and the national 61.1%).
In SA1 39203, socio-economic advantage (irsad decile) account for 7 — above average. In SA1 39203, economic resources (ier decile) account for 2, well below average. In SA1 39203, education & occupation (ieo decile) account for 8, above average.
